Personal Life
Michell was born in Pretoria, South Africa but spent significant parts of his childhood in Beirut, Damascus and Prague as his father was a diplomat. He was educated at Clifton College where he became a member of Brown's house in 1968. He studied at Cambridge University and in 1977, he won the prestigious Royal Shakespeare Company Buzz Goodbody Award (named after the acclaimed British female director Buzz Goodbody, who committed suicide at the age of 29). Michell graduated from Cambridge in 1977.
Michell was married to the actress Kate Buffery, but they are now divorced. They have two children, daughter, actress Rosie and son Harry. His partner is now Anna Maxwell Martin, with whom he has a daughter.
